Key Responsibilities
  • Provide direct patient care, including assessment, planning, implementation, and evaluation of nursing care.
  • Administer medications and treatments as prescribed, monitoring for adverse reactions and side effects.
  • Collaborate with interdisciplinary teams, including physicians, therapists, and other nursing staff, to ensure optimal patient outcomes.
  • Maintain accurate and up-to-date patient records, ensuring compliance with hospital and regulatory standards.
  • Monitor patient conditions and make adjustments to care plans as needed.
  • Educate patients and families on disease management, treatment options, and preventive healthcare.
  • Respond to emergency situations promptly and appropriately.
  • Assist in the orientation and mentoring of new staff, if applicable.
  • Adhere to all hospital policies, procedures, and quality standards to ensure safe and effective patient care.
